Screenshots made with the S or Shift+S hotkeys will be stored in a folder called VSeeFace inside your profile’s pictures folder ... birthday wrapping paper rollsWebBy default, OBS creates one scene for you to work with right away. You can see it in the bottom left box called Scenes. You can rename it or create a new one if you like. The next step is to add a source for OBS to know what to capture.
